Thieves have ripped out a heavy metal safe containing an undisclosed amount of money from a concrete wall within the administration block of the Ankaful Psychiatric Hospital in the Central Region. The incident was suspected to have happened Monday night. Workers reported to work Tuesday morning to find three offices within the administration block broken into and the safe removed from a wall in the accountant’s office and taken away together with a revenue bag. A female accountant and her assistant, who allegedly misappropriated 551,732.64 cedis from the account of a private hospital in Takoradi, have been put before court. Linda Nana Donkor and Magdalene Kublenu Walagyo were arraigned Tuesday on charges of conspiracy to steal, stealing and falsification of electronic documents. Prosecutors say both Donkor and her assistant Walagyo, are in charge of collecting monies from clients of UQ Hospital and depositing same into the hospital’s main account. The Supreme Court has in a unanimous decision ruled that courts are to sit on weekends and public holidays to deal with issues that affect personal liberty. A private legal practitioner, Martin Kpebu, in September 2016 dragged the Attorney General to the apex court demanding a declaration that portions of the Holidays Act that bars the courts from dealing with cases that affect personal liberty are unconstitutional.
